Our Expertise - Talk Therapy - But what is it?

Talk therapy, also known as psychotherapy or counseling, is a form of mental health treatment that involves conversations between a therapist and an individual or group. It is a collaborative process in which the therapist provides a supportive and nonjudgmental environment for the individual to explore their thoughts, emotions, behaviors, and experiences.


The goal of talk therapy is to help individuals understand and resolve emotional and psychological difficulties, improve their mental well-being, and develop effective coping strategies. It can be beneficial for a wide range of mental health concerns, such as depression, anxiety, stress, relationship issues, trauma, grief, and more.


During talk therapy sessions, the therapist engages in active listening, empathy, and understanding, while encouraging the individual to express their feelings and thoughts openly. They may ask questions, offer insights, provide guidance, and teach practical skills to help the individual gain self-awareness, develop healthier perspectives, and make positive changes in their lives.


Talk therapy can take various forms, including:


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T): Focuses on identifying and modifying negative thought patterns and behaviors to improve emotional well-being.


Psychodynamic Therapy: Explores how past experiences and unconscious processes influence current thoughts, feelings, and behaviors.


Humanistic Therapy: Emphasizes personal growth, self-acceptance, and the individual's capacity for change and self-actualization.


Family Therapy: Involves working with families to improve communication, resolve conflicts, and strengthen relationships.


Group Therapy: Involves multiple individuals who share similar concerns and come together to support and learn from each other in a therapeutic setting.


Talk therapy provides a supportive and confidential space for individuals to gain insight, develop coping skills, and work towards positive change. It can be short-term or long-term, depending on the individual's needs and goals. The effectiveness of talk therapy depends on the therapeutic relationship, the individual's willingness to engage in the process, and the therapist's expertise.
